A Tour in Scotland. MDCCLXIX

by Pennant, Thomas

Description:

Engravings by Mazell and Murray. Rare first edition of Thomas Pennant’s (1726-1798) celebrated account of his Scottish journey, undertaken in 1769. One of the most important 18th-century travel narratives, which commences in Chester, offers a vivid and observant description of Scotland at a moment of profound social and cultural transition. Pennant, a distinguished naturalist and antiquarian, combined accurate observation with lively travel writing, recording landscapes, settlements, natural history, and the customs of Highland life. His sympathetic and detailed portrayal of the Highlands played a significant role in reshaping contemporary perceptions of Scotland in the post-Jacobite era, contributing to the emerging Romantic fascination with its scenery and traditions

A foundational work of British travel literature, A Tour in Scotland was widely influential, informing and inspiring later travellers and writers, including Johnson and Boswell on their own Scottish tour.

Mullens & Swann p. 466; Nissen ZBI 3110.
